How much do part time intake coordinator jobs pay per hour?

As of Aug 17, 2026, the average hourly pay for part time intake coordinator in Ohio is $19.23,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$15.77 and $21.35 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is a part time intake coordinator?

A Part Time Intake Coordinator is a professional who assists organizations, such as healthcare facilities or social service agencies, by managing the initial intake process for new clients or patients. They gather essential information, complete paperwork, verify insurance, and help coordinate the first steps of care or service. Working part-time, they typically handle these responsibilities during specific hours or days rather than full-time. Their role is crucial for ensuring smooth onboarding and providing a positive first impression for clients. Attention to detail, strong communication skills, and organizational abilities are important qualities for this job.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a part time intake coordinator?

To thrive as a Part Time Intake Coordinator, you need strong organizational skills, attention to detail, and experience with client intake procedures, often supported by a background in healthcare, social services, or administration. Familiarity with electronic health records (EHR) systems, scheduling software, and secure data management is commonly required. Excellent communication, active listening, and empathy are critical soft skills for engaging with clients and supporting team coordination. These competencies ensure efficient processing of client information, accurate record-keeping, and a positive experience for both clients and staff.

What are the typical challenges faced by a part time intake coordinator, and how can they be managed effectively?

Part Time Intake Coordinators often encounter challenges related to balancing a high volume of client inquiries with administrative responsibilities, all within limited weekly hours. Managing time efficiently and prioritizing urgent cases is crucial to ensure clients receive timely assistance and accurate information. Effective communication and collaboration with other team members, such as case managers and administrative staff, can help streamline the intake process and prevent bottlenecks. Staying organized and utilizing client management systems will further support a smooth workflow in this dynamic role.

Our history

Talkiatry was founded in 2020 by Dr. Georgia Gaveras, a triple board-certified psychiatrist in adult, child and adolescent psychiatry, and Robert Krayn, a patient who experienced firsthand the challenges of accessing care. Together, they set out to reimagine outpatient psychiatry by building a model that supports both patients and clinicians, while expanding access to mental healthcare.

Our culture

Our clinical community includes 700+ psychiatrists and PMHNPs and 300+ therapists practicing across 32 languages.
